Proving negligence involves demonstrating that another party owed you a duty of care, breached that duty, and caused your brain injury as a result. This requires gathering evidence such as accident reports, witness statements, and expert medical opinions. Our legal team is experienced in building strong cases to establish fault and liability. We work with accident reconstruction professionals and medical experts to establish the clear connection between negligence and your injury.
Immediately after a brain injury accident, seek medical attention to diagnose and treat your injury. Document the incident details, gather contact information of involved parties and witnesses, and avoid giving statements to insurance companies without legal advice. Early steps are vital to protecting your health and legal rights. Additionally, preserve all evidence from the scene, take photographs, and keep records of all expenses related to your injury and treatment.

Brain injury claims often include damages for future medical care and rehabilitation based on expert assessments. This ensures that long-term needs related to the injury are financially supported. We work with medical professionals to quantify these needs accurately. Future damages are calculated based on your expected lifetime medical expenses, therapy costs, assistive devices, and ongoing care requirements resulting from the brain injury.
